RUPTIME(1C)                                                        RUPTIME(1C)



NAME
     ruptime - show host status of local machines

SYNOPSIS
     ruptime [ -a ] [ -r ] [ -l ] [ -t ] [ -u ]

DESCRIPTION
     Ruptime gives a status line like uptime for each machine on the local
     network; these are formed from packets broadcast by each host on the
     network every three minutes.

     Machines for which no status report has been received for 11 minutes are
     shown as being down.

     Users idle an hour or more are not counted unless the -a flag is given.

     Normally, the listing is sorted by host name.  The -l , -t , and -u flags
     specify sorting by load average, uptime, and number of users,
     respectively.  The -r flag reverses the sort order.

FILES
     /usr/spool/rwho/whod.*   data files

SEE ALSO
     rwho(1C), rwhod(1M)

BUGS
     Not all systems keep load statistics that are usable by rwhod(1M).
